In Lee Child's Gone Tomorrow, Theresa Lee is introduced as a Homicide Detective in the New York Police Department. The NYPD detective joins Jack Reacher in his new investigative journey in the book and briefly becomes a romantic interest for the character. Interestingly, as reports have confirmed, Theresa Lee's name has been changed to Tamara Green in the show.
Given how Reacher's seasons 1, 2, and 3 accurately adapted their respective books and did not even change the names of most main characters, it is a little surprising that Theresa Lee's name has been changed. She is being portrayed by Sydelle Noel, who is best known for her role in GLOW.

While no official statements have confirmed why Theresa's name has been changed to Tamara, one story beat from Reacher season 3 might already have answers.

In Reacher season 3, Storm Steenson portrayed one of the primary side characters, Teresa. Although Teresa did not have much screen time, she was used as a plot device to explain why Susan Duffy was so dead set on catching Xavier Quinn. Since Teresa's rescue was one of Reacher's key missions in Reacher season 3, her name was consistently dropped throughout the installment.
